    <collection>The Forty Hadith of Imam Nawawi</collection>
    <book>The sanctity of Muslim blood; three cases permitting capital punishment</book>
    <narrators>
      <narrator>Ibn Masood</narrator>
    </narrators>
    <grade>Sahih</grade>
    <text>The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) said, “It is not permissible to spill the blood of a Muslim except in three [instances]: the married person who commits adultery, a life for a life, and the one who forsakes his religion and separates from the community.”</text>
